There is most certainly decay. There is even a developer post from about one week ago(by Lord_Pall, I think) that mentions that they have upped the decay rate. That being said, I've not noticed any decay on components yet, but I haven't been keeping track of all the numbers of all the components in my ships.


I do know that the ship chassis value decays with about 10% per death. I've tested it myself (and had to replace a ship because of it). Here's my short test, using good old instruments like pen and paper:


First, I wrote down the current andmax value of my X-wing (939.1/939.1).


Second, I got my trusty X-wing destroyed and repaired. The Chassis value was now 845.2/845.2.


Third, just to check that I didn't read wrong, I sent my dear X-wing to ship heaven once more and after this repair the chassis was 761/761.


I'd rather see a high decay rate on components, and no/very little decay on the actual chassis. As it is, many players will barely even afford ships due to the obscene amounts of resources needed...

It fairly configurable. You can either bind each mouse button (Or any button for that matter) to fire all weapons, one weapon or a weapon group. The weapon groups are also possible to configure, which is pretty much a must on ships like the B-wing (with four lasers, two missile launchers and one counter measure launcher).
